How We Fix Supply Line Break Water Damage in Bellevue, WA
When you call us for supply line break water removal, our team will arrive quickly and assess the situation. We’ll use specialized equipment to contain the damage, prevent further water flow, and begin the drying process. Our technicians are trained to use moisture meters to track the drying process and ensure that your home is completely dry before we leave.
Step 1: Containment and Assessment
We’ll use a combination of tarps and drying equipment to contain the water and prevent further damage. Our technicians will assess the situation and find out the best course of action for your specific situation.
Step 2: Water Removal and Extraction
We’ll use powerful pumps and vacuums to remove standing water from your home. Our technicians will work efficiently to reduce the amount of time and equipment needed to get the job done.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
We’ll use specialized equipment to dry your home completely, including moisture meters to track the drying process. Our technicians will work to ensure that your home is completely dry before we leave.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
We’ll use specialized cleaning solutions and equipment to clean and sanitize your home, removing any remaining water and debris.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Touch-ups
Our technicians will conduct a final inspection to ensure that your home is completely dry and free of any remaining water damage. We’ll make any necessary touch-ups to ensure that your home is back to normal.

Supply Line Break Water Removal Cost in Bellevue, WA
The cost of supply line break water remov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Bellevue, WA. Our estimates are based on industry standards and take into account the equipment and expertise needed to complete the job effectively.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Containment and Assessment | $500 – $2,500 | Severity of damage, size of affected area |
| Water Removal and Extraction | $1,000 – $5,000 | Amount of water, equipment needed |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$1,500 – $6,000 | Size of affected area, equipment needed |
| Cleaning and Sanitizing | $500 – $2,000 | Severity of damage, equipment needed |
| Final Inspection and Touch-ups | $200 – $1,000 | Severity of damage, equipment needed |

Common Questions About Supply Line Break Water Removal
Will you fix the underlying cause of the leak?
Yes, our technicians will work to identify and fix the underlying cause of the leak, whether it’s a cracked pipe, a faulty valve, or another issue.
How long will it take to dry my home?
The drying time will depend on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our technicians will work to dry your home as quickly and efficiently as possible, but it’s not uncommon for the process to take 3-5 days or more.
Will you work with my insurance company?
Yes, our team has experience working with insurance companies and will help you navigate the claims process to ensure that you get the coverage you need.
Can I stay in my home during the restoration process?
It’s generally not recommended to stay in your home during the restoration process, as it can be hazardous and may cause further damage. Our technicians will work to reduce disruptions and ensure that your home is safe and dry as quickly as possible.
